Grape Seed As A Herbal Supplement



Grape plants have long been used for their medicinal properties (the health benefits of wine have been applauded since ancient times) , but it is actually the seed that contains the most beneficial components. Grape seed contains impressive amounts of flavonoids, which are phytochemicals with antioxidant properties.

Grape seed oil is used in Europe to increase blood flow in patients with vascular diseases. It is also believed to prevent the formation of plaque on arteries. The high antioxidant content means that taking grape seed oil can also help prevent cancer, minimize damage caused by fibromyalgia, and help soothe skin irritations like eczema and psoriasis.

Grape seed oil is also beneficial for eye health. It can help ease eye strain and, by improving blood flow to the eye, slow down the process of macular degeneration and the formation of cataracts. This supplement is also known to ease light sensitivity and improve night vision. This knowledge about grapes and eye health has been known since ancient times—an ointment made from the juices of the grapevine was applied to eyes to cure diseases, though today we know that ingestion of the oil from the seeds is a more efficient way to use the health benefits of grapes for healthy sight!

Grape seed oil is relatively safe, with no known interactions. However, pregnant or breastfeeding women should avoid supplements like grape seed oil. Consulting with a physician is always a good bet before starting any regimen that includes the use of dietary supplements.
